INTERNAL MEMO – Awards Night Engraving

To the dispatch desk: the fourteen trophies for the Silverpine Awards Night are crated and ready for transfer to Marwick Engraving. Each trophy is wrapped individually and matched to the engraving list inside the lid; please verify the count before sealing. Turnaround is three days, so booking the courier today is essential. The confidential hand-over instruction appears below.

handover note for yagef-bagep: the drudor pelius courier leaves the kasdor zorvan norir ledger at gate 8016 under passcode 755406

Welcome to the Thornbury greenhouse project! One quirk you'll hit early: the humidity sensors in bays 3–5 drift upward about 2% per week, so the controller applies a weekly recalibration offset — don't "fix" readings manually or you'll fight the scheduler. Flag any drift over 5% to the hardware crew. To push controller firmware updates, you'll sign builds with the team key shown here.

signing key of bagap-yawep = bky13_TbfT6ZMUoGJo2

Pricing Overview: Corvane Product Line (Managers Only)

This page summarises current pricing for the Corvane line for board reference. The standard tier sits at a 42% gross margin; the extended-support tier at 55%. Competitive benchmarking against regional rivals shows headroom of roughly 6–9% on the standard tier without material churn risk. A revision is proposed for next fiscal year. The confidential positioning rationale follows below.

management briefing: Project Ulavan slips by two quarters because of the staffing delay.